Golf Courses

Celtic Manor golf is spectacular. To begin with, there is the state-of-the-art Top Tracer Range, where guests can home in their skill with swing stats, ball speed and use the ultimate practice tool before the game. Downstairs is a well-equipped pro-shop where you can stock up on premium brands and balls prior to hitting the track.

The Twenty Ten is the holy grail of golf at Celtic, the Ryder Cup venue is nothing short of iconic, landing its place as one of the best golf courses in Wales. Measuring a staggering 7493 yards from the back-tees, the parkland course has a very links-like feel, with a long rough and water features to play around.

The Montgomerie course, named after its renowned architect Colin Montgomerie, is another stunning parkland course. The dramatic tee shots exhibit magnificent views over the Usk Valley, showcasing the cascading hills which are incorporated into the course.

Roman Road, the OG of all the Celtic Manor courses, was founded in 1995 and since hosting many European Tour events. This par-70 course measures 6406 yards, that has looks over the Severn Estuary has some spectacular holes, including the 16th- its signature. Although the shortest hole on the property, this short par-3 has three bunkers protecting the green demanding accuracy from its players.

Finally, there are two luxurious clubhouses, who often host some big names. While you enjoy your post-game drinks, you can people watch at the 19th holes reminiscing over your round. Top tip- Celtic Manor provide complimentary shuttles across the resort, ensuring you make your tee times and back again for evening reservations.

Accommodation

Celtic Resort welcome its guests to 5-star luxury, with 330 newly refurbished rooms that ensures every golfer has all amenities to rest and recoup after their round. Each en-suite is adorned with marble features, with well-crafted design, adding to the hotels opulent feel.

For golfers who have come in larger groups, there are the Hunter Lodges available. Each lodge is immaculately positioned with views over the rolling hills of the resort, offer open-plan spaces with sauna and hot tubs – perhaps making it a great venue for a stag-do golf trip. Restaurant & Bars

Guests are truly spoilt for choice when staying at the magnificent Celtic Manor Resort, with eight exceptional restaurants and a variety of bars offering diverse dining experiences.

In the heart of the Resort Hotel, The Olive Tree awaits with its spectacular buffet, presenting a delightful range of dishes to satisfy every palate. For those seeking an elevated dining experience, the award-winning Signature Sixth Floor Restaurant, Steak on Six, offers premium steaks in an elegant and sophisticated ambiance.

Over at the Manor House, PAD serves up delicious Asian-inspired cuisine in a refined and inviting setting. For a more casual atmosphere, the Cellar Bar provides the perfect spot to unwind, featuring wide-screen televisions and a delectable bar menu.

If you're looking for a change of scenery, The Grill, overlooking the picturesque Roman Road Course, offers a delightful menu in a charming setting. Another excellent option is Rafters at The Twenty Ten Clubhouse, an award-winning restaurant that promises a memorable dining experience with its exquisite menu.

Adding to the resort’s impressive lineup is the newly opened Casa Kitchen & Bar. This vibrant restaurant brings a fresh mediterranean dining option to the resort, with an innovative menu and lively atmosphere that’s perfect for golfers.

A short drive from the main resort, you’ll find Newbridge on Usk, nestled in a picturesque spot on the river. This 2 AA Rosette restaurant serves delicious locally-inspired country fare in a charming and scenic setting, making it a perfect escape for a delightful meal.

Spa & Leisure

There are a wide range of activities for guests to choose from if the excellent golfing facilities weren’t already enough. With two spas onsite, Celtic Manor provides a heavenly sanctuary from the stresses and strains of everyday life, with The Forum Health Club offering a 20 metre swimming pool, jacuzzi, state of the art gym and spa café.

The Forum Spa and Ocius Treatment Rooms have 20 treatment rooms between them, offering a wide range of treatments from Elemis and Jessica Nails. Alternatively you can work up a sweat in the health club gym, before a soothing treatment, or unwinding in the poolside loungers and gaze up to the starlit ceiling. Location

The Celtic Manor Resort is idyllically situated in the Usk Valley, near Newport, Wales (two minutes from Junction 24 of the M4). Accessing this venue is exceptionally easy with Newport Train Station located just three miles away.

Nearby

See the sights of Wales’ lively capital, Cardiff can also be done with consummate ease, with a short 15-minute train journey from Newport.

Montgomerie Course

Breaks from £129
Style: Woodland

Designed by Ryder Cup Legend Colin Montgomerie, the first and last holes of this challenging par 69 parkland golf course were based on the foundation of the original Wentwood Hills golf course, with the land from the old Coldra Woods Academy course being used to construct the fascinating layout of The Montgomerie. Featuring deep pot bunkering and some tricky greenside swales, this golf course has plenty of natural hazards and an “inland links” feel to it
